1 DESCRIPTION AND OPERATION
1.1 Function
АСМ-IP2.1 provides conversion of a digital communication interface into an analog
interface to ensure loud-speaking operative-process communication with subscriber
intercoms equipped with an analog interface.
ACM-IP2.1 is installed on the DIN-rail 35 mm wide in communication cabinets, racks
located in offices and control rooms.
АСМ-IP2.1 appearance is shown in Figure 2.
The housing is made of polyamide. The housing color under RAL is 7035.
Note — The manufacturer is entitled to change the overall appearance of the product
if this does not affect installation dimensions and operation.
ACM-IP2.1 contains embedded software and configuration data stored in memory,
which allows it to communicate with other digital communication system users directly,
handle priority connections and manage communication and indication modes. An IP-
network based on standard network equipment is used to facilitate communication.
Within the digital intercom system, the ACM-IP2.1 provides the following functions:
−functions of subscriber device in loud-speaking systems under Armtel-IP and
SIP protocols providing reception and transmission of an analog signal
(amplifiers, integration of analog intercoms);
−control (commutation) of external actuating devices 48V (relay, lamp-type
signaling device);
−recording of voice messages from terminal devices into internal memory;
−playback of voice messages recorded in the internal memory of terminal units;
−providing of calls priorities, set during configuration of the subscriber units, via
SIP and Armtel-IP protocols.
Configuration of АСМ-IP2 is performed from the administrator's PC, on which
the "IPN2 Configuration Software" RU.RMLT.00041-01 should be installed.

Figure 1 — Example of ACM-IP2.1 operation within distributed intercom and alarm systems
For example, organization of simplex communication sessions on routes:
– DIS-IP2 — Ethernet interface — Fast Ethernet Switch — Ethernet interface — ACM-
IP2.1 module — analog intercom;
– analog intercom — АСМ-IP2.1 module — Ethernet interface — Fast Ethernet
switch — Ethernet interface — loud-speaker DW-IP2/CCS/DIS-IP2.
Organization of loud-speaking Public address / General alarm sessions on routes:
– DIS-IP2 — Ethernet interface — Fast Ethernet Switch — Ethernet interface — ACM-
IP2.1 — external amplifier — 4x Relay modules — loudspeakers (up to 8 pcs.);
– analog intercom — АСМ-IP2.1 module — Ethernet interface — Fast Ethernet
switch — Ethernet interface — АСМ-IP2.1 module — external amplifier — loud-speaker
(power is defined by specifications of the external amplifier).

1.5 Design
1.5.1 ACM-IP2.1 represents a printed board with installed electrical components. The
board is installed into the housing (see Figure 2) intended to secure a standard DIN-rail
35 mm.
ACM-IP2.1 weight does not exceed 0,2 kg. External appearance and overall dimensions
are given at Figure 2.
1 –line connector (connection of 1-8 control lines); 2 –transparent flap cover; 3 –housing;
4 –nameplate; 5 –offset lines 5…8 on/off switch (counter call on 5-8 control lines);
6 –offset lines 1…4 on/off switch (counter call on 1-4 control lines); 7 –CP on/off switch (А-В
line output transformer central point control); 8 –CPU0 operation readiness LED indicator;
9 –CPU1 LED (mot used); 10 –DEF button (reset to factory settings); 11 –RES button (reset);
12 –Eth connector to connect to Ethernet network with PoE support; 13 –A B CP +V connector
to connect to analog control line and transformer central point control line;
14 ––IN –OUT 0 V 0 V connector to connect to external 48VDC power supply;
15 –attachment latch.

Figure 2 shows connectors:
1– Line connector for connection of discrete lines (control lines), software
configurable or as input for connection, for example, direct call key of the
terminal units or as output (for load connection);
12 – Eth connector RJ-45 8P8C for connection to Ethernet network (including PoE
power supply).
Indicators on Eth connectors:
1) green – ON when there is physical connection with Ethernet network,
blinking when network interface is active (receiving or transmitting of
data packages);
2) orange – ON when the unit is powered from the PoE source;
When supplied from an external power supply, LEDs become green and orange
meaning that there is power supply and Ethernet connection.
13 – connector for connection to the analog line and transformer central point
control line.
14 – connector for connection of external DC power supply 48 W. In case of no PoE,
it is used as an input for power supply connection. When ACM-IP2.1 is supplied
from PoE, it is used as an output for supplying external devices connected to
this ACM-IP2.1 (for example, an analog intercom). The total power consumption
of ACM-IP2.1 and external device in this case must not exceed the maximum
permitted loading power according to PoE class. Connector pins are also used
for Line control lines. + pin is used as a common wire to connect buttons or dry
contacts to lines; – pin is used to connect to loading lines such as actuation
relays.
Figure 2 shows controls and indicators:
5, 6 – Offset lines 5…8 and Offset lines 1…4 on/off switches for counter calls on
control lines 5-8 and 1-4, respectively.
The switch controls switching of reference voltage of Line 1 — Line 8 (OFFSET).
Reference voltage must be corrected when arranging a connection between
centrals along analog lines to implement the priority function in case of a
counter call.

ACM-IP2.1 ANALOGUE SUBSYSTEMS MODULE
User Manual
armtel.com стр. 11/32
info@armtel.com © Armtel
ENG
Positions of «Offset lines 5…8 and Offset lines 1…4 switches:
a) О– off (position on default);
b) I –on (voltage shift is activated to detect a counter activation of the line
(for example in case of simultaneous incoming and outcoming calls).
7– CP on/off switch to control the output transformer central point of line A-B. The
switch must be on to transmit a control signal by activating the device via the
middle point, for example, if ACM-IP2.1 is used together with an analog
intercom or controlled amplifier. For all other devices, the switch is
recommended to be turned off.
Positions of CP switch:
a) О– off (position on default);
b) I –on (for analog intercoms).
8– CPU0 operation readiness indicator LED. It flashes if the integrated software is
loaded and operates correctly.
9– CPU1 LED (not used in this version of the device).
10 – DEF button to reset to factory settings. If the button is kept pressed with ACM-
IP2.1 pressed, network settings and user data will be reset to default settings. To
reset, press and hold the button for seven second, then wait until ACM-IP2.1
reboots.
11 – RES reset button. To reset ACM-IP2.1, shortly press and depress the button,
and wait until rebooting.
Figure 2 does not show the following elements within the housing of ACM-IP2.1:
−S1 – on/off DIP-switch to select Linux boot medium (Linux OS). Options are
given in Table 4. Connector for a memory card is located on underside of ACM-
IP2.1 board.

2.3 Preparation for use
Preparation of the ACM-IP2.1 for use shall be carried out by the manufacturer’s
representatives, or personnel trained to operate Armtel LLC products. The main preparation
of the product for use is carried out during installation and connection.
ACM-IP2.1 is prepared for operation in several steps:
−removing ACM-IP2.1 from the shipping container and/or consumer package;
−checking the scope of supply of ACM-IP2.1 according to product passport;
−visual inspection of the device for damage (cracks, dents, chips, etc). During
visual inspection, pay attention to the integrity of the product, condition of
connectors, buttons, switches (all buttons/switches shall be easy to press and
must easily return to the original position);
−check settings of Offset lines 5…8, Offset lines 1…4 and CP switches as per 1.5.1;
−connect the product to a PC, on which RU.RMLT.00041-01 IPN2 System
Configuration Software Tool is installed, and to the power supply, set the IP
address for operation on a shared network or turn on the DHCP. To do it, the
connection to a PC via an IP network can be used. The product may be powered
by a PoE plus injector or a 48 VDC external power supply.
Note — During manufacturing, each ACM-IP2.1 is assigned with the identical IP-
address by default: 192.168.100.10, subnet mask: 255.255.255.0. If DHCP is turned on, the
product is automatically assigned an IP address when connecting to a shared network.
ATTENTION! DEVICES WITH THE SAME IP ADDRESSES ARE NOT ALLOWED ON
THE SAME NETWORK. THE IP ADDRESS MUST BE SET BEFORE CONNECTING TO
THE SHARED NETWORK.
−enter a record on the set IP address or DHCP in the “Special notes” section
of the product passport;
−disconnect from power supply and PC;
−install and connect the ACM-IP2.1 at the operating site (see 2.4).

2.4 Installation, connection, and dismantling
Safety precautions given in 2.2 must be observed during installation, connection and
dismantling of the product.
The location in the cabinet should be chosen taking into account the convenience of
access to the module for connecting the power and communication wires, as well as for
maintenance.
2.4.1 Installation
To attach ACM-IP2.1 at the workplace, the housing has a latch to secure to DIN-rail
35 mm. The unit is attached as per Figure 3:
−place ACM-IP2.1 above a DIN-rail 35 mm and engage the upper part of the DIN-
rail with the upper groove of the device (a);
−hold ACM-IP2.1 at the housing cover and gently press the device to the
mounting surface (b);
−after the attachment latch is fixed on the DIN-rail, make sure that the attachment
is secure.

2.4.2 Connection
2.4.2.1 АСМ-IP2.1 can be connected:
а) via 100BaseT Ethernet interface. The on-site connection is carried out using
multi-wire UTP type cable, crimped with RJ-45 plugs, which is connected to Eth
RJ-45 connector (pin assignment is given in Table A.1). On the other side, the
cable is connected to a network unit with PoE plus injector function.
б) via –IN –OUT 0 V 0 V connector (pin assignment of the connector is given in
Table А.1) by a cable with maximum wire cross-section of 28 to 12 (AWG)
(maximum cross-section of crimped wire is 3.3 mm2) crimped by a connector
from the scope of supply. On the other end, the cable is connected to the
external 48 VDC power supply min. 15 W.
2.4.2.2 A terminal device is connected to the Line connector (pin assignment of the
connector is given in Table А.1) by a cable with maximum wire cross-section of 28 to 16
(AWG) (maximum cross-section of crimped wire is 0.5 to 1.5 mm2) crimped by a connector
from the scope of supply.
2.4.2.3 A B CP +V (pin assignment of the connector is given in Table А.1) is connected
to an analog line and transformer central point control lines. Connection is done using a
cable 28 to 16 (AWG) in cross-section (cross-section of crimped wire is 0.5 to 1.5 mm2)
crimped by a connector from the scope of supply. Terminal devices are connected on the
other side of the cable.
2.4.2.4 The availability of reverse polarity protection at the ACM-IP2.1 input prevents
damage to the device, and so the performance of the device is not affected when reverse
polarity supply voltage is applied across contacts 1, 3 and 4 of -IN –OUT 0 V 0 V connector.
Contact 2 (-OUT) is not protected against reverse polarity and is an output.
2.4.2.5 Connection examples are given in Appendix B.
2.4.2.6 Connection cables are not included in the scope of supply.
